Question 1: Which of the following is equivalent to (2³)⁴ ÷ 2⁶?
- 2²
- 2⁶ (Correct answer)
- 2⁸
- 2⁴
Correct answer: 2⁶
(2³)⁴ = 2¹² and 2¹² ÷ 2⁶ = 2⁶.
Question 2: A car depreciates in value by 15% per year. If it is currently worth $20,000, what will it be worth after 2 years?
- $14,450 (Correct answer)
- $17,000
- $14,000
- $15,200
Correct answer: $14,450
Value = 20,000 × (0.85)² = 20,000 × 0.7225 = $14,450.
Question 3: If vectors u = (3, −1) and v = (2, 4), what is the dot product u · v?
- 10
- 2 (Correct answer)
- 14
- −2
Correct answer: 2
u · v = (3)(2) + (−1)(4) = 6 − 4 = 2.
Question 4: What is the range of the function f(x) = −x² + 4?
- y ≥ 4
- y ≤ 4 (Correct answer)
- all real numbers
- y ≥ −4
Correct answer: y ≤ 4
The parabola opens downward with vertex at (0, 4), so f(x) ≤ 4 for all x.
Question 5: How many distinct arrangements are there of the letters in the word 'LEVEL'?
- 30 (Correct answer)
- 60
- 120
- 24
Correct answer: 30
LEVEL has 5 letters with L repeated 2× and E repeated 2×: 5! / (2! × 2!) = 120/4 = 30.
Question 6: If tan(θ) = 5/12 and θ is in the first quadrant, what is cos(θ)?
- 5/13
- 12/13 (Correct answer)
- 5/12
- 13/12
Correct answer: 12/13
With opposite = 5, adjacent = 12, hypotenuse = 13; cos(θ) = adjacent/hypotenuse = 12/13.
Question 7: A solution is 30% acid. How many liters of pure acid must be added to 20 liters of this solution to make it 50% acid?
- 6 L
- 8 L (Correct answer)
- 10 L
- 12 L
Correct answer: 8 L
(0.30×20 + x) / (20 + x) = 0.50 → 6 + x = 10 + 0.5x → x = 8.
